Disability Ramp Installation in Kansas City, KS

Disability ramp installation services provide accessible solutions for homeowners seeking to improve entryways and exterior pathways. These projects typically involve constructing ramps that accommodate mobility devices such as wheelchairs, scooters, or walkers, ensuring safer and easier access to homes. The scope of work can include installing ramps at front or back entrances, connecting different levels of a property, or modifying existing structures to meet accessibility needs. Property owners often want to understand the types of ramps available, the materials used, and how the installation can be tailored to fit the specific layout of their property.

Before requesting disability ramp installation, property owners usually seek information about the dimensions required for their mobility devices, local building codes or accessibility standards, and the space available for the ramp. They may also want guidance on slope requirements, handrail options, and surface materials to ensure safety and durability. Clarifying these details helps determine the most suitable design and ensures the installation provides a functional, compliant, and long-lasting solution for improved accessibility.

Disability Ramp Installation Questions

What types of properties can benefit from disability ramp installation? Residential homes, apartments, and commercial buildings can all be improved with accessible ramps to enhance mobility and safety.

What materials are used for disability ramps? Common materials include aluminum, wood, and concrete, chosen for durability and suitability to the property's needs.

Are custom ramps available for unique property layouts? Yes, ramps can be customized to fit specific space requirements and accessibility needs.

What should property owners consider before installing a ramp? Consider the location, slope, and building codes to ensure the ramp provides safe and easy access.
